Joomla.it Forum

Componenti per Joomla! => Gestione sito multilingua => : girubino 09 Oct 2009, 17:17:11

: Joom!fish -traduzione sottomenu
: girubino 09 Oct 2009, 17:17:11
Ciao a tutti, è la prima volta che utilizzo joomfish e... tutto ok.. almeno finora... perchè mi sono accorto che non mi apre i sottomenu..

Se vado nel menu "Translation" di joomfish e seleziono i menu, le mie voci ci sono e sono tutte tradotte, compresi sottomenu, ma quando vado a vedere il sito in inglse e clicco sul link che ha il sotto menu questo non si apre... mentre naturalmente in italiano si!
c'è qualche accorgimento che devo adottare... ?
grazie
Giuseppe

: Re:Joom!fish -traduzione sottomenu
: girubino 09 Oct 2009, 17:48:34
scusate... era un problema di cache...
Questa cache di joomla proprio non la capisco...
Saluti e scusate ancora ma guro che ci ho perso mezzora buona come un deficente
Giuseppe
: Re:Joom!fish -traduzione sottomenu
: vales 09 Oct 2009, 23:47:27
Ciao girubino,

grazie per aver postato la soluzione.

Ricorda di mettere [Risolto] nell'oggetto del primo post.
: Re:Joom!fish -traduzione sottomenu
: Flatline 06 Feb 2010, 09:01:51
scusate... era un problema di cache...
Questa cache di joomla proprio non la capisco...
Saluti e scusate ancora ma guro che ci ho perso mezzora buona come un deficente
Giuseppe

Ciao.
Ho anch'io lo stesso problema: con la cache disattivata funziona tutto bene, mentre attivando la cache, i sottomenu spariscono.
Posso chiederti come risolvesti tu questo problema ?

Grazie
: Re:Joom!fish -traduzione sottomenu
: Flatline 06 Feb 2010, 13:42:29
Per meglio spiegare il mio problema: il sito è questo:

http://www.kbmilano.com

Come vedete le voci di menu "Collezioni" e "Feste ed eventi" contengono dei sottomenu, che vengono visualizzate correttamente sia in Italiano che in Inglese, perchè adesso la cache è disattivata.

Se la attivo, in Italiano continuano ad essere visualizzate correttamente; invece in Inglese spariscono.
 
Ciao,
F.
: Re:Joom!fish -traduzione sottomenu
: maicolstaip 06 Feb 2010, 16:54:35
Ciao Flatline,
mettiamola così:
la cache è un sistema che permette di velocizzare la visualizzazione del sito da parte degli utenti.
Cosa fa?
Tiene memoria del sito in modo che il secondo utente che lo visita non debba aspettare che si ricarichi completamente (infatti viene caricata la cache e non tutto il sito)

Se la cache è di 15 minuti, essa non verrà aggiornata per 15 minuti e quindi un utente che usa il sito con la cache abilitata non vede i cambiamenti che hai apportato negli ultimi 15 minuti.
Se fai una nuova voce di menu, una traduzione, un articolo in quei 15 minuti, un utente non lo vedrà.

Dirai, allora  a cosa serve?
Serve quando un sito è definitivamente on line, perchè spesso velocizza notevolmente l'uso da parte degli utenti, specialmente quando ne hai tanti contemporaneamente.

Poi, sta a te fare degli esperimenti per vedere se sia il caso di abilitarla, non c'è una regola generale.

Questa è una spiegazione poco tecnica ma spero che ti possa instradare  ;)
: Re:Joom!fish -traduzione sottomenu
: Flatline 06 Feb 2010, 17:48:53
Questa è una spiegazione poco tecnica ma spero che ti possa instradare  ;)

Purtroppo no.
Le finalità e il modo in cui la cache "dovrebbe" funzionare mi erano ben chiari.
Il punto è che la visualizzazione in Italiano del sito funziona esattamente così.
Quella tradotta in Inglese tramite Joomfish - invece - non lo fa.
Nonostante non venga apportata alcuna modifica al sito, e in condizioni di cache perfettamente ripulita, le voci di submenu spariscono !

Grazie lo stesso.
: Re:Joom!fish -traduzione sottomenu
: maicolstaip 06 Feb 2010, 17:50:49
Scusa ma io le traduzioni dei submenu le vedo correttamente  :o
: Re:Joom!fish -traduzione sottomenu
: Flatline 06 Feb 2010, 18:28:35
Scusa ma io le traduzioni dei submenu le vedo correttamente  :o

Sul mio sito, intendi?
Prova adesso, che ho riattivato la cache.
In Italiano funge, in Inglese no  :(
: Re:Joom!fish -traduzione sottomenu
: d-force 06 Feb 2010, 19:18:05
Se ho capito bene, a me dà un problema solo su "Philosophy"...

Per caso usi un componente Sef?

: Re:Joom!fish -traduzione sottomenu
: maicolstaip 06 Feb 2010, 20:29:53
Ciao,
ma che browser usate?
Con FF nessun problema in nessuna voce di menu.
Sempre che la cache sia ancora attivata.
: Re:Joom!fish -traduzione sottomenu
: Flatline 07 Feb 2010, 10:59:36
d-force > No, il problema ce l'ho su "Collections" e su "Parties and Events"; in Inglese non compaiono i submenu; in Italiano invece sì.
No, non uso un componente Sef

maicolstaip > Provo con FF 3.5.7. MSIE 8, Chrome 4.0. Il risultato purtroppo non cambia: le voci dei submenu "Collections" e "Parties and Events" in Inglese non compaiono; in Italiano invece sì.

Grazie a entrambi per lo sbattimento.

F.
: Re:Joom!fish -traduzione sottomenu
: Flatline 08 Feb 2010, 15:57:06
Per quante cornate gli abbia dato, il mio problema permane.
Dovrò rassegnarmi a disattivare la cache?

E' una vera seccatura, perchè le prestazioni ne risentono pesantemente.

D'altronde, con la cache attivata, i submenu in Inglese non vogliono proprio saperne di funzionare :-(

F.
: Re:Joom!fish -traduzione sottomenu
: roman12 17 Mar 2011, 18:21:46
Ciao, la soluzione c'è. Mi ero imbattuto nello stesso problema.
Devi andare in panello di controllo joomfish e selezionare - traduzioni. Da lì scegli la lingua e nella finestra accanto scegli - moduli. Ti si apre la lista dei moduli. Entri dentro: menu principale e da lì disattivi la cache per la lingua inglese. Stessa roba per le altre lingue.
In bocca al lupo.